Game Insider #19: July '08 Newsletter
![]() ![]() ![]() The Battle Begins "Man the cannons and lay waste to all those who oppose our flag!" It's time to choose a side and take to the sea as a Privateer! Aye, Ship Privateering has finally arrived to the Live Game after being docked (temporarily) on our Test Server -- a special thanks to all our Unlimited Access / Test Server Players who helped us test and debug this great new addition to the game. Side with the Frenchman Pierre by setting sail from the privateering port of Ile D'Etable De Porc -- or side with the Spaniard Garcia by departing from Isla De La Avaricia, then with your "private license" in hand and able crew in tow, set off for some pillaging and plundering on the high seas! Both Basic and Unlimited Access players can engage in Privateering, just pick a side and take up that flag in battle! Pirate "Lords" on both islands will additionally challenge you with quests that upon completion will gain you gold and reputation points - not to mention a special Spanish or French tattoo! Wear the tattoo with pride, mate, it shows your allegiance and that you're a veteran Privateer! ![]() The Rise of the Privateer - Lore Chapter 3 'Tis a time of feuding as a French and a Spanish "lord" struggle for control over newly discovered territories.
